ICoNS Launches "Challenging Cases": Forging Global Consensus in Real-Time
January 2026 — As genomic newborn screening (gNBS) moves from the laboratory to the front lines of public health, the global community is encountering a new frontier of clinical and ethical complexity. To meet this challenge, ICoNS is proud to announce the official launch of our Challenging Cases sessions.
Where the Experts Seek Answers
The field of genomic screening is evolving at a breakneck pace, often leaving clinicians and researchers with more questions than answers. These sessions provide a unique, professional space where the world’s leading experts collegially dissect and resolve the most complex and ambiguous cases submitted from the field.
These are the cases that perplex even the most seasoned specialists—scenarios where there are no clear-cut answers and the path forward is unmapped. By bringing these difficult situations into the light during our monthly consortium calls, ICoNS provides a platform to consider every angle, ensuring that no clinician has to navigate these complexities alone.
A Dynamic Debut
The initiative was spearheaded and launched by Dr. Laurence Faivre, who chaired the inaugural session this January with the support of a dedicated Review Committee. What began as a formal presentation quickly transformed into a high-energy, dynamic exchange. We witnessed extraordinary engagement from our 90+ global attendees, turning the session into a masterclass in collaborative problem-solving.
